In the news this week: Oxfam apologises for demonising gender critics in its promotional video for LGBT Pride Month, Westminster is accused of foisting the views of pro-abortion and sex ed activists on Northern Ireland schools, and a Christian MP stands up to a UN committee’s religious intolerance.
